WebAn example of a stack in real life is a stack of cafeteria trays. Workers add clean trays to the top, and you take the tray from the top of the stack. A stack is also called a LIFO list. LIFO stands for Last-In-First-Out. Implementation of a stack A stack (of bounded size) can be efficiently implemented using an array b and an int variable n ... Web25 giu 2024 · Ideally a Stack class should just support operations like push(), pop(), peek() and empty(). But as Stack is a sub class of Vector, it also has the ability to access, insert and remove an element by its index. (You can check all the methods it supports here) This basically break the LIFO definition. For example, this code block works fine. Web14 apr 2024 · Stacks: A stack is a collection of elements that supports two main operations: push and pop. Elements are added to the top of the stack using the push operation, and removed from the top of the stack using the pop operation.
